2. What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files stored on your device (computer, tablet, or mobile) when you visit a website. They allow the website to recognize your device and remember information about your visit, such as your preferences, login state, or items in a shopping cart. Cookies do not contain viruses and cannot access data on your hard drive beyond the information you have voluntarily shared.
